Definisi dan arti dari "swamp"dalam bahasa Inggris

01

rawa, paya

an area of land that is covered with water or is always very wet
swamp definition and meaning
Contoh-contoh
The swamp's ecosystem played a crucial role in filtering water and providing habitat for numerous species of birds and amphibians.
Ekosistem rawa memainkan peran penting dalam menyaring air dan menyediakan habitat bagi banyak spesies burung dan amfibi.
02

rawa, lumpur

a state overwhelmed by difficulties, responsibilities, or complexity
Contoh-contoh
He navigated a swamp of conflicting regulations during the project.
Dia menavigasi rawa peraturan yang bertentangan selama proyek.
to swamp
01

menggenangi, membanjiri

to flood or cover something with water, making it hard to use or move through
Contoh-contoh
The basement was swamped after the pipe burst.
Ruang bawah tanah terendam setelah pipa pecah.
02

menggenangi, menenggelamkan

to become drenched, submerged, or overrun, often by liquid
Contoh-contoh
The dock swamped under the weight of the waves.
Dermaga itu terendam di bawah beratnya ombak.
03

membanjiri, membebani

to overwhelm someone or something with a large quantity of work, tasks, messages, or requests
Contoh-contoh
Students were swamped with assignments before the deadline.
Para siswa kebanjiran tugas sebelum tenggat waktu.
